DATE : 1st July, 2022 ORDER :

1.

Admittedly, the points raised in these petitions are covered by the decision rendered by this Court in Writ Petition No.10381/2015 and connected matters, which were decided on 19-01-2016. The said decision is placed on record at Exhibit-C of the present petitions.

2.

There is no dispute that the petitioners are similarly situated.

2 921-WP-10776-2021.odt 3.

For the reasons stated in the order passed in Writ Petition No.10381/2015 and connected matters, Writ Petitions are allowed. The impugned order below Exhibit-1 in M.A. (R) No.59/2014 and M.A. (R) No.60/2014, passed by 3rd Joint Civil Judge, Senior Division, Jalna dated 26/04/2016, is hereby quashed and set aside. 4.

The applications i.e. M.A. (R) No.59/2014 and M.A. (R) No.60/2014 are hereby allowed.

5.

The matters are restored on the file of the reference Court i.e. 3rd Joint Civil Judge, Senior Division, Jalna. The proceedings under Section 18 of the Land Acquisition Act, 1894 are restored to the file of the learned Civil Judge, Senior Division, Jalna for decision of the reference afresh after making acquiring body as party to such proceedings and permit the acquiring body to file their statements and proceed with the reference in accordance with law.
